Stephanie Carvajal is a Senior Vice President on Teneo’s Teneo Connect team, based in New York.
Stephanie advises global clients on the strategy and execution of high-impact convenings, executive engagements and global event platforms that bring together leaders across business, government and philanthropy. She works closely with senior executives to design and deliver curated forums and experiences around major international gatherings that strengthen relationships, elevate thought leadership and advance strategic priorities.
Prior to joining Teneo, Stephanie led operations and event strategy at Handshake Partners, where she oversaw more than 50 high-profile engagements alongside global forums including the World Economic Forum in Davos, COP27 and COP28, the Milken Global Conference, the Vatican Investor Summit and the United Nations General Assembly.
Earlier in her career, Stephanie held roles in fundraising, events and operations at the New York City Mayor’s Office and several nonprofit organizations, including the United Nations Refugee Agency (UNHCR).
Stephanie holds a B.A. in Political Science from the University of Florida.
